Meng Guo is a scholar working on Computational Mechanics, Signal Processing and Biomedical Engineering. According to data from OpenAlex, Meng Guo has authored 45 papers receiving a total of 621 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 19 papers in Computational Mechanics, 18 papers in Signal Processing and 9 papers in Biomedical Engineering. Recurrent topics in Meng Guo’s work include Speech and Audio Processing (17 papers), Advanced Adaptive Filtering Techniques (16 papers) and Hearing Loss and Rehabilitation (7 papers). Meng Guo is often cited by papers focused on Speech and Audio Processing (17 papers), Advanced Adaptive Filtering Techniques (16 papers) and Hearing Loss and Rehabilitation (7 papers). Meng Guo collaborates with scholars based in China, Denmark and The Netherlands. Meng Guo's co-authors include Jesper Jensen, Richard C. Hendriks, Søren Holdt Jensen, Jianda Shao and Richard Heusdens and has published in prestigious journals such as Nature Communications, Optics Express and IEEE Transactions on Signal Processing.
